Figure 4.
Novel object recognition deficit of NR1 KD mice is reversed by M1 PAM administration. NR1 KD animals showed no preference for the novel object when treated with vehicle. Pretreatment with VU6004256 resulted in dose-dependent increases in recognition index. Acute treatment with 10 mg/kg VU6004256 in WT animals resulted in an increase in recognition index (n = 8–10/treatment group, * p < 0.05, two-way ANOVA followed by Bonferroni’s post hoc test).
